本文实例讲述了PHP的HTTP客户端Guzzle简单使用方法。分享给大家供大家参考,具体如下: 首先来一段官方文档对Guzzle的介绍: 然后cd到网站根目录,执行Composer命令下载Guzzle:(Linux环境) compose...
php
codeception api测试
安装 php vendor/bin/codecept generate:suite api 配置 actor: ApiTester modules: enabled: - REST: url: http://serviceapp/api/v1/ depends: PhpBrowser ...
codeception安装及使用
PHP是一种广泛应用于互联网应用开发的编程语言,Codeception是一种基于PHP语言的测试框架。它可以让开发人员更加容易地进行自动化测试,从而提高代码的质量。在PHP编程中,Codeception的使用非常常见。下面,本文...
think-filesystem文件存储驱动
安装 composer require tp5er/think-filesystem 阿里云OSS 安装驱动 composer require xxtime/flysystem-aliyun-oss ^1.5 'oss' => [ 'type' => 'oss', 'credentials'=>[//若...
thinkphp6 阿里云oss
基于 xxtime/flysystem-aliyun-oss 轻度封装tp 安装 composer require death_satan/thinkphp-aliyun-oss 初始化 修改配置 config/filesystem.php 文件 <?php return [ // 默认磁盘 '...
PHP无限分类
顶级分类下面有子分类,子分类下面又有孙分类,子子孙孙无穷尽也。 怎么让这个分类功能支持无限个,说是无限,其实也是有限。算法可以无限,实际使用中总是有限,毕竟计算机的内存是有限的。 无限分类实现...
手工下载php的composer软件包,如何让项目自动加载包里的类
有的时候需要手工下载php的composer包 1.将下载好的包放到项目的vendor目录下,比如包名topthink/think-view 2.然后查看软件包目录(vendor/topthink/think-view)下的composer.json文件,找到autoload, ...
微信分享s d k
php
TP邮箱、手机号、特殊字符验证
$phone = $this->isInvalidPhone($param['phone']); if(!$phone){ ReturnAjax([], '手机号格式错误', 2001); } // 验证邮箱 public function isInvalidEmail($string) { // $string ...
php中的date和strtotime函数妙用,上个月下个月
php中的两个常用的日期相关函数date和strtotime,相信大家一定不陌生。但我们平时使用都只是基本功能,什么时间戳变日期格式,日期格式变时间戳。 其实这两个函数还有更深的用法: 1、date函date(format,ti...